The management of the Royal Institute of Art consists of the Vice-Chancellor, Pro Vice-Chancellors, Head of Administration and Head of Department, who, together with a student representative, also make up the university’s Management Council.
Vice-Chancellor
Sanne Kofod Olsen leads the organization and is the Royal Institute of Art’s foremost artistic and academic representative. The Vice-Chancellor holds chief responsibility for the state authority as head of the Royal Institute of Art and is a member of the University College Board.

Head of Administration
Malin Hell is the Head of Administration with responsibility for preparing matters upon which the Vice-Chancellor or the University College Board must decide. The position includes ensuring professional support for education and research, and that the university fulfils its obligations as a state authority.
